Murfreesboro, Tennessee – Pubblog announces the release of version 1.0.7 of PixSteward and PixSteward Lite, the essential Flickr backup, interface and database for Macintosh. PixSteward Lite is available for $9.99 in the Mac App Store.

PixSteward lets users download their Flickr photostreams to their Mac, along with any titles, tags, descriptions, geographic info and EXIF data they have entered online. With PixSteward’s powerful relational database, users can edit metadata as well as find, sort and export single images or multi-picture sets from their Flickr archive — even when they aren’t connected to the Internet. PixSteward is a powerful, easy-to-use, professional-grade interface to Flickr. PixSteward Lite limits users to a single Flickr account and restricts the saved location of the image database file to comply with Apple “sandboxing” requirements for distribution via the Mac App Store.

PixSteward is especially helpful for Flickr users who need to manage multiple Flickr accounts. PixSteward downloads and stores the original images from Flickr — JPEGs, GIFs and PNGs — so artwork containing transparency or vector paths (Photoshop JPEG) is preserved.

Photostream search with PixSteward is far faster and more sophisticated than online. PixSteward allows you to enter up to 20 terms per search and lets you name and save frequently-used searches. Database experts can “roll their own” by editing the SQL statement directly.

Results of searches can be rapidly exported from PixSteward for use in other image-editing applications and the user has an option to export “sidecar” text files containing the combined Flickr and EXIF metadata along with pictures.

When you are connected to the Internet and logged in to Flickr, PixSteward permits editing picture metadata, thus insuring sync is maintained between the cloud and your PixSteward local archive.

System Requirements:
* OS X 10.6 or later
* 2.8 MB

Pricing and Availability:
PixSteward Lite 1.0.7 is $9.99 USD (or equivalent amount in other currencies) and available worldwide exclusively through the App Store in the Photography category.
